Hepatitis B Immunoglobulin

Drug #1559

Hepatitis B Immunoglobulin is a sterile liquid freez-dried preparation containing immunoglobulins, mainly immunoglobulin G (IgG), derived from the plasma from selected immunised donors having specific antibodies against hepatitis B surface antigen. Hepatitis B immunoglobulins are used for the passive immunisation of persons expose or possibly exposed to hepititis B virus.

Pharmacokinetics

Elimination: plasma half-life is 22 days.

Indications

Hepatitis B Immunoglobulin is primarily indicated in conditions like Prevention of hepatitis B, after exposure.

Contraindications

Hepatitis B Immunoglobulin is contraindicated in conditions like Hypersensitivity.

Side Effects

Hepatitis B Immunoglobulin is known to cause more or less tolerable side effects which are usually transient. These include Chills, Facial flushing, Fever, Headache, Hypersensitivity , Nausea.

Warnings / Precautions

It should be used with caution in patients with any pre-existing illnesses, blood disorders or any allergy, including any drug allergy. It should be used only when clearly needed during pregnancy. Pateints should be manitored for serum anti-HBS antibody levels regularly.

Interference in Pathology

Hepatitis B Immunoglobulin may interfere in the diagnosis of Misleading + results in serological testing, Interferes with serological tests for red cell anti bodies e.g coombs test..
